Quick facts:Illyana Sharrad
Illyana Sharrad is a High-Secretary of the UEE government during the administration of Imperator Kelos Costigan. [1] [2]
2950 elections
Nearing the end of Costigan's term, she enrolled in the 2950 UEE imperatorial Elections, making it to the last five for the final vote. Her ongoing campaign combined with her regular duties as high secretary caused a very busy schedule for her. One of her primary campaign pointers was to fast track one pressing infrastructure need for each UEE system. This is called the "Jump Start" program. [2]
Competition
Officially, the Universalist party had endorsed Sharrad as their candidate for the 2950 election. But Imperator Costigan (who is part of the same party), had never officially declared his support, possibly due to the fact that his son Titus Costigan was also in the race for Imperator under the Universalist party. Costigan had met with party chair Aadi Svensson prior to the secondary vote to pressure him into endorsing Sharrad, which soured the work relationship between Sharrad and Costigan. Making matter worse between the two Universalist candidates were a series of attack ads specifically targeting Sharrad that hit the Spectrum just before the secondary vote. Titus' campaign denied involvement. Despite this, Sharrad still lost several key parts of the Universalist voting block to Titus. [3]
Jump Start program
The Jump Start program essentially allows governor's councils in each system to propose a single initiative that will serve the needs of the residents there. The purpose of the program is then to fast track the plans, hopefully boosting the long-term health of the system's economy, and benefiting from the potential return on investment when carrying it out. That in turn could create jobs, inject capital, and improve the lives of that system's residents.[2] The program has received widespread support from public sector unions across the Empire. [3]
In order to fund this program, Sharrad proposed that the funding for the Synthworld project be temporarily paused in order to review the project's progress and set attainable goals. [2]
Active Engagement initiative
Another one of Sharrad's plans is a program that would essentially require anyone, whether they’re a citizen or civilian, to “actively engage” in an authorized civil service program while taking advantage of certain benefit programs. In an interview with Eria Quint on Showdown, Sharrad explained that not participating in the program will not cause anyone lose access to the rights and services guaranteed to them in the Common Laws. "Those that need a little extra help will get it by giving a little back". Some of the options available would even lead to civilians gaining Citizenship.[2]
Conflicting start of office
In an interview Sharrad gave with Eria Quint on Showdown, she mentioned she had been working as high secretary for five years (as of June 2950). However, her being high secretary has been mentioned as early as 2942. [2]
